    I cancelled my landline with ACS in February 2023. Out of the blue, on August 1, 2023 my credit card was charged by ACS for $471.68. I had to spend time getting in contact with ACS and determining what was going on. After some time, ACS said it was an erroneous charge. I asked why they felt they could use my credit card when I no longer had an account with them. They said when I cancelled my service, I left my credit card on file so they had a right to use it! No one at ACS asked me if I wanted my credit card to remain on file when I cancelled my service. I asked for ACS to refund the money to my credit card. They said they did not issue refunds via credit card, only check. It took two months to receive the check from ACS. Essentially they borrowed my money interest free. Watch out!
